在Vue中显示格式化文本可以通过以下步骤实现:
data
属性定义一个变量来存储格式化后的文本。mounted
生命周期钩子函数中,使用API发送请求获取需要格式化的文本数据。可以使用axios
库或者fetch
函数来发送HTTP请求。{{ }}
)将格式化后的文本显示出来。下面是一个示例代码:
<template>
<div>
<p>{{ formattedText }}</p>
</div>
</template>
<script>
import axios from 'axios';
export default {
data() {
return {
formattedText: ''
};
},
mounted() {
axios.get('/api/getFormattedText')
.then(response => {
this.formattedText = response.data;
})
.catch(error => {
console.error(error);
});
}
};
</script>
在上面的示例中,我们使用了axios
库发送了一个GET请求来获取格式化后的文本数据。你可以根据实际情况修改请求的URL和参数。
这个示例中的formattedText
变量存储了格式化后的文本数据,然后在模板中使用插值语法将其显示出来。
对于API的具体实现和返回的格式化文本内容,这里无法提供具体的答案。你可以根据实际需求来设计和实现API,并确保返回的数据是符合格式化要求的。
推荐的腾讯云相关产品:腾讯云云函数(Serverless Cloud Function),它是一种无需管理服务器即可运行代码的计算服务。你可以使用云函数来实现API,并将其与Vue项目集成。腾讯云云函数的产品介绍和文档可以在以下链接中找到:腾讯云云函数
领取专属 10元无门槛券
手把手带您无忧上云